Xi Jinping Leads Meeting on Flood Control and Drought Relief

Beijing, July 1: The Politburo of the Central Committee of the Communist Party of China (CPC) convened a meeting on June 30 to study and implement flood control and drought relief efforts. General Secretary Xi Jinping presided over the meeting.

The meeting emphasized that this year, during the main flood season, China is likely to experience more frequent extreme weather and climate-related events, raising concerns over both drought and flooding. All sectors and relevant departments are urged to take concrete steps to effectively address flood control, drought relief, and disaster management.

It was highlighted that the safety of people’s lives should always be the top priority, with improvements needed in monitoring and forecasting accuracy. Immediate and decisive actions must be taken to relocate people to safe areas to prevent large-scale casualties.

The meeting also stressed the necessity for prompt and efficient emergency rescue and disaster relief operations. Enhancements in the preparation of forces, equipment, and materials, as well as strengthening overall planning and preparedness, are essential to improve rescue capabilities in extreme situations.

CPC committees and governments at all levels were called upon to earnestly implement the decisions and plans of the CPC Central Committee and strictly enforce the accountability system for flood control and drought relief.
